The only thing left to see is longevity but so far I am thrilled. I could have replaced every light in the TT with panels for $53, that would have been a few bulbs at the dealer. It will be so nice to be able to use the house lights again while boodocking.
When installing the little white plus adapters I found that if I put a small bulge in the contact wire that they worked well. Just leaving them flat on the plug didn't work at all. I cleaned the reflecting plate with denatured alcohol so the backing on the panel would stick.
